Math Tips | Guide to Mastering Mathematics


Mathematics is a subject that often evokes mixed emotions—some students love it, while others find it challenging and intimidating. The truth is, math is a skill that anyone can improve with the right mindset, strategies, and consistent practice. Whether you’re struggling with basic concepts or aiming to excel in advanced topics, this blog provides actionable tips to help you master math effectively.

Why Learning Math is Important

Math is more than just numbers and equations; it’s a way of thinking that develops problem-solving skills, critical reasoning, and logical analysis. These skills are essential not only for academic success but also for real-life applications such as budgeting, decision-making, and understanding data. By improving your math skills, you open doors to countless opportunities in education and career paths.

Actionable Math Tips for Students

1. Develop a Positive Mindset Toward Math

Many students struggle with math because they believe they’re “not good at it.” Changing this mindset is the first step to success:

Embrace challenges as opportunities to learn.

Avoid comparing yourself to others; focus on your own progress.

Celebrate small victories to build confidence.

2. Create a Consistent Study Schedule

Consistency is key when it comes to mastering math:

Dedicate specific time slots each day to studying math.

Break study sessions into manageable chunks (e.g., 30 minutes of focused practice followed by a 5-minute break).

Use planners or apps to track your study routine and ensure regular practice.

3. Focus on Understanding Concepts

Memorizing formulas without understanding their underlying principles can lead to confusion:

Ask yourself why a formula or method works instead of just how it works.

Relate abstract concepts to real-life scenarios (e.g., using percentages while shopping).

Use visual aids like graphs, charts, or diagrams to grasp complex ideas.

4. Practice Regularly

Math is a subject that requires hands-on practice:

Solve different types of problems to strengthen your understanding of concepts.

Start with simpler problems before moving on to more challenging ones.

Revisit problems you struggled with earlier to reinforce learning.

5. Use Online Resources and Tools

The internet offers a wealth of resources for learning math:

Watch tutorial videos on platforms like Khan Academy or YouTube.

Use apps like Photomath or Wolfram Alpha for step-by-step solutions.

Explore interactive games and quizzes that make learning fun.

6. Summarize Key Concepts

Creating summaries helps reinforce your understanding:

Write down formulas, definitions, and key steps in solving problems in a notebook.

Use color-coded notes or flashcards for quick revision.

Regularly review your summaries before exams or quizzes.

7. Join Study Groups

Collaborating with peers can enhance your learning experience:

Discuss challenging problems and share different approaches to solving them.

Teach concepts to others—it’s one of the best ways to solidify your knowledge.

8. Seek Help When Needed

Don’t hesitate to ask for assistance if you’re struggling:

Approach your teacher during office hours for clarification on difficult topics.

Consider hiring a tutor or joining online forums where you can ask questions.

Strategies for Specific Math Topics

Algebra

  1. Understand the meaning of variables and how they function in equations.

  2. Practice simplifying expressions and solving for unknowns.

  3. Use graphing tools to visualize equations.

Geometry

  1. Memorize key formulas for area, perimeter, and volume.

  2. Draw diagrams whenever possible—it helps in visualizing problems.

  3. Familiarize yourself with the properties of shapes and angles.

Trigonometry

  1. Learn the basic trigonometric ratios (sine, cosine, tangent) and their applications.

  2. Practice converting between degrees and radians.

  3. Use unit circles to understand relationships between angles and ratios.

Calculus

  1. Focus on understanding limits and derivatives before moving on to integrals.

  2. Break down complex problems into smaller steps.

  3. Use online graphing tools to visualize functions.

Common Mistakes Students Make in Math

  1. Skipping Steps: Always write down each step when solving problems; skipping can lead to errors.

  2. Cramming Before Exams: Math requires consistent practice over time; avoid last-minute cramming.

  3. Ignoring Weak Areas: Identify topics you struggle with early on and dedicate extra time to mastering them.

  4. Overreliance on Calculators: Practice mental math and manual calculations to strengthen your number sense.

Frequently Asked Questions (FAQs)

1. How can I improve my math skills effectively?

To improve your math skills, practice regularly, understand the underlying concepts rather than just memorizing formulas, and utilize online resources such as tutorials and practice problems. Joining study groups can also enhance your learning experience.

2. How much time should I dedicate to studying math each week?

Aim for at least 3–5 hours of focused study each week, depending on your current level and goals. Consistency is key, so try to incorporate short daily sessions rather than cramming all at once.

3. What should I do if I struggle with a specific math topic?

If you’re struggling with a specific topic, seek help immediately. Ask your teacher for clarification, find online tutorials that explain the concept, or consider hiring a tutor for personalized assistance.

4. Are there any effective study techniques for math?

Yes! Effective study techniques include practicing problems regularly, summarizing key concepts and formulas, using visual aids like graphs and diagrams, and teaching the material to someone else to reinforce your understanding.

5. How can I stay motivated while studying math?

To stay motivated, set achievable goals, reward yourself for completing tasks, and remind yourself of the importance of math in everyday life and future career opportunities. Engaging with math in real-world contexts can also boost motivation.

6. What resources are available for learning math?

There are numerous resources available for learning math, including online platforms like Khan Academy, Coursera, and YouTube tutorials. Additionally, textbooks and educational apps can provide valuable practice and explanations.

7. How do I prepare for a math exam effectively?

To prepare effectively for a math exam, review all relevant materials, practice solving past exam papers or sample problems, create summaries of key formulas, and ensure you understand the concepts behind the problems rather than just memorizing solutions.

8. Is it beneficial to study math in groups?

Yes! Studying in groups allows you to share different perspectives on problem-solving, clarify doubts with peers, and teach each other concepts. Collaborative learning can enhance understanding and retention of material.

9. Should I use a calculator when studying math?

While calculators can be helpful for complex calculations, it’s essential to practice mental math and manual calculations to strengthen your number sense and problem-solving skills. Use calculators as a tool but not as a crutch.

10. How can I develop better mental math skills?

To develop better mental math skills, practice basic arithmetic regularly without using a calculator. Engage in games or apps that challenge your mental calculation abilities and try to solve problems in your head before writing them down.
